New Emergency Center in Frisco
Celebrates Open House

Legacy ER Offers State-of-the-Art Services

September 9, 2008 – FRISCO, TEXAS – Legacy ER, a new emergency care center in Frisco, will host an open house Saturday, September 20 from 10 a.m. to noon, at 9205 Legacy Drive (at Main Street). Festivities will include outdoor events to attract families with children of all ages, including face painting with donations to benefit the Leukemia and Lymphoma Society (LLS)—Team in Training, balloon art, a medical-themed clown and a bounce house. In addition, visitors are welcome to refreshments, may tour the facility and will be eligible for prizes, including several iPods and $100 VIP cards that can be used in savings toward Legacy ER services.

Legacy ER combines a full-service, freestanding emergency room and leading edge urgent care center in one innovative facility, and board certified emergency physicians treat everything from minor ailments to life-threatening emergencies.

“We are looking forward to showcasing our new center to the community and sharing the exciting features that make our facility unique,” said Kirk D. Mahon, M.D., one of the three founders of Legacy ER.

Legacy ER is open daily 9 a.m. to 9 p.m. and accepts all private insurance. For more information, visit LegacyER.com.
